Daily Highlights: 12.13.2010
- Asian stocks, Dollar, copper climb as China refrains from increasing rates.
- Australia overhauls banking rules; said it would improve banking competition.
- China pledges to change growth model in 2011, tackle prices, grow quickly.
- Chinese Premier Wen to visit India in bid to build mutual trust amid disputes over territory, trade.
- China risks 'rush' to tighten in 2011 after inflation accelerates past 5%.
- EU leaders set to focus on debt crisis facility as ECB grapples with banks.
- Euro falls to $1.3202 in morning European trading as EU nations to meet amid debt crisis.
- Fed to buy $105 bln in bonds in coming month.
- Obama signals brighter vision of tax reform; to address income inequality.
- OPEC dismisses $90 oil price as 'blip,' maintains production targets again.
- Retail sales probably rose in November as consumers boosted US recovery.
- U.K. retailers see Christmas at least as good as 2009.
- A&P, the troubled grocer, fil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ection Sunday.
- Airgas tells Court Board is at odds over Air Products hostile takeover bid.
- BYD plans to test market an all-electric battery in the U.S. next year.
- Carlyle faces setback for listing plans; CFO departure could delay debut.
- China Datang's wind power unit said to raise $643M in Hong Kong IPO.
- Church & Dwight announces pricing of $250M of 3.35% senior notes due 2015.
- Colonial Properties Trust may sell shares equivalent to as much as $100M.
- Daimler AG plans to invest €3B in China by 2015.
- GDF Suez says that it plans to spend $3B on gas plant in Cameroon.
- GE leads suitors for oilfield services firm Wellstream; plans a 800M pound-plus bid.
- GE raises quarterly dividend 17% to $0.14 per share from $0.12/sh.
- GMAC can sell foreclosed homes in Maine after Judge rejects homeowner bid.
- Honeywell to hike annual dividend 10% to $1.33/sh.
- Pfizer stops clinical trials of Thelin and initiates voluntary product withdrawal.
- Sanofi-Aventis extends $18.5B unsolicited offer for US-based Genzyme.
